The Underwriter is responsible to achieve profit, growth, service and expense objectives through basic financial analysis and management of a book of businessPrimary Responsibilities:

  • Works to underwrite cases where general and some complex underwriting principles will be applied and a solid command of the rating tools is required
  • Frequency of case review will be based on team lead's decision and in accordance to case level review policies
  • Obtains Field Office staff acceptance of expense and reserve levels necessary to achieve planned expense recovery and underwriting gain objectives
  • Executes financial management on a book of business
  • Assists and participates in creating and negotiating financial arrangements and settlements through Sales with some client and / or broker contact when necessary
  • General communications will be mostly with internal sales
  • There will be limited interactions with brokers
  • Underwrites several new firms or new coverage and major benefit revisions
  • Provides direction to other areas in resolving service or claim issues that have financial implications
  • Maintain up -to - date knowledge of applicable dental and vision plans and related products
  • Explain underwriting principles and pricing recommendations to sales and brokers and be able to present position based on your knowledge of underwriting, competition, product, understanding of the client needs, etc
  • Develop and maintain positive working relationships with Underwriters, AMT members and multi-site coordinators
  • Identifies needs and makes recommendations for new/improved underwriting processes and procedures

Required Qualifications:

  • Must have strong financial analysis, problem solving and critical decision-making skills
  • Proficiency with MS Office suite products 1+ years professional business experience, preferably in Underwriting, Accounting or Finance
  • Exhibits effective personal communication skills in the areas of listening, speaking and writing
  • Must possess professional written and verbal skills and formal presentation abilities
  • Handles sensitive and confidential information and confidences appropriately and diplomatically
  • Years of post-high school education can be substituted/is equivalent to years of experience

Preferred Qualifications:

  • 1+ years of Underwriting experience in healthcare industry
  • BA/BS degree
  • Ability to prioritize and respond effectively to numerous demands
  • Demonstrates negotiation skills
  • Handles difficult situations diplomatically
  • Solid organizational skills
